Question black smoke

When every I get on the gas there is a black cloud of smoke. And the back of the car has black specs all over it

Having excessive black smoke with tar forming on the bumper is a sign of running too rich. If you have any chips piggybacked onto the PCM, take them off.

If your car has been tuned, get in contact with whoever tuned it.
